      After implementing remote VTEP learning for logical routers (FDP-1385) and support for encapsulating/decapsulating traffic to/from learned VTEPs (FDP-1386) the already existing support for BGP dynamic-routing integration for OVN logical routers should allow for OVN router subnets, NAT and LB IPs to be advertised through BGP EVPN as well.

      We need to ensure that relevant multinode e2e tests are added for:

      • topologies with BGP+EVPN peers between OVN nodes/deployments (FRR running the control plane)
      • gateway OVN routers or distributed OVN routers with gateway ports that have dynamic routing enabled AND
      • a type=vxlan router port AND
      • have NAT and/or LBs configured

      In such cases, remote peers should learn routes through BGP+EVPN to reach the advertised OVN network/NAT/LB IPs.
